Output 31ba07e1ca264054e1895e25df5ab1319140e7c49b71f21f1e9f5a0eedbbc585:1

value
107016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88dbd704f653efedd08ec1c93d6d1dc699deddeb OP_EQUAL
address
3EAfBNt7Z6nbEgcgwRrbqybxUiV1q7uxtP
transaction
31ba07e1ca264054e1895e25df5ab1319140e7c49b71f21f1e9f5a0eedbbc585
spent
true